Differential D13200 Diff 31965 src/applications/phortune/controller/PhortuneProductListController.php
Changeset View
Changeset View
Standalone View
Standalone View
src/applications/phortune/controller/PhortuneProductListController.php
| Show All 11 Lines | public function processRequest() { | ||||
| $query = id(new PhortuneProductQuery()) | $query = id(new PhortuneProductQuery()) | ||||
| ->setViewer($user); | ->setViewer($user); | ||||
| $products = $query->executeWithCursorPager($pager); | $products = $query->executeWithCursorPager($pager); | ||||
| $title = pht('Product List'); | $title = pht('Product List'); | ||||
| $crumbs = $this->buildApplicationCrumbs(); | $crumbs = $this->buildApplicationCrumbs(); | ||||
| $crumbs->addTextCrumb('Products', $this->getApplicationURI('product/')); | $crumbs->addTextCrumb( | ||||
| pht('Products'), | |||||
| $this->getApplicationURI('product/')); | |||||
| $crumbs->addAction( | $crumbs->addAction( | ||||
| id(new PHUIListItemView()) | id(new PHUIListItemView()) | ||||
| ->setName(pht('Create Product')) | ->setName(pht('Create Product')) | ||||
| ->setHref($this->getApplicationURI('product/edit/')) | ->setHref($this->getApplicationURI('product/edit/')) | ||||
| ->setIcon('fa-plus-square')); | ->setIcon('fa-plus-square')); | ||||
| $product_list = id(new PHUIObjectItemListView()) | $product_list = id(new PHUIObjectItemListView()) | ||||
| ->setUser($user) | ->setUser($user) | ||||
| Show All 29 Lines | |||||